Stable release

The current stable release of the ACX "plain driver" is v0.3.38, which does not support WPA.

Development

If you want to follow or contribute to the development of the driver, you should either follow or subscribe to these mailing lists:

You are encouraged to CC both of them when sending e-mail.

The current development is exclusively focused towards getting the Mac80211 version in shape. The Plain_driver should be considered to be in maintenance mode (i.e. new releases will not add newer functionality, only bug fixes).

The latest development code can always be found at the following repository:

You can either browse the code or get your own copy and start hacking!

Assuming that you have the git version control system installed and you are familiar with it, simply issue the following command to clone the repository:

 git clone git://gitorious.org/acx-mac80211/mainline.git

Current status

  • Slow pace development
  • WPA2 in STA mode confirmed to be working with kernel 2.6.24 and acx111.
  • Working, but unstable on AR7-based routers (with either mini-PCI or VLYNQ interfaces).
  • Locking issues on SMP machines.
  • The current HEAD needs some tweaking (adaption to the latest mac80211 API changes) before it can be compiled against the 2.6.26 kernel.

Troubleshooting

Edit: The module may generate in some cases many debug messages looking like: acx: unknown EID 45 in mgmt frame at offset 86...; causing sometimes a system freeze.

You may disable these debug messages when loading the module:

 modprobe acx debug=0

On a debian system, you may create a file /etc/modules.d/acx containing:

 options acx debug=0
